Commissioning compensator-based IMRT on the Pinnacle treatment planning system

Summary

This study optimized the commissioning of compensator-based intensity-modulated radiation therapy (IMRT) by determining the optimal brass compensator thickness for beam modeling. This approach improved dose calculation accuracy and validated new dosimetry methods for clinical IMRT plans.
